What are some of the instances in which Ezeulu has shown arrogance in the novel?

ezeulu seem to be a proud man as seen in most cases in the novel. I'd like to have a review of such events.

Ezeulu is a prideful man, but never moreso than when it comes to things that affect him personally. He goes against the wishes of his clan, he insists his son receive a "white man's" education, he refuses to perform his duties as required, and he follows his own will..... not the god's (Ulu).
